TITLE:

title
Fare Agreement: Pass Purchase and Administration (Salt Lake City Corporation)
end

AGENDA ITEM TYPE:
Service or Fare Approval

RECOMMENDATION:
Approve the new Pass Purchase and Administration Agreement with Salt Lake Corporation.

BACKGROUND:
On June 22, 2022 the Board of the Authority approved Amendment 2 to the Eco Pass Trip Rewards Agreement with Salt Lake City Corporation which extended the effective date of the contract through June 30, 2023 and approved the discount of five percent. Unfortunately, the contract expired before the amendment could be executed, therefore a new agreement became necessary.

DISCUSSION:
Staff recommends approval of a new Pass Purchase and Administration Agreement with Salt Lake City Corporation replacing the June 22 Board approved Amendment. The title of the agreement has been updated at the recommendation of Board staff, however all terms of the agreement remain the same as the previously approved amendment.

ALTERNATIVES:
1. Not approve the modification and renegotiate a new contract price and term
2. Not approve the modification and forgo revenue

FISCAL IMPACT:
Estimated revenue of $65,000 to $75,000 which represents a fifteen to thirty percent increase over 2021-22 revenue.
